What is an anchor producer?

Anchor Producers are media professionals who work closely with news anchors to plan, coordinate, and produce news broadcasts. They are responsible for developing show rundowns, selecting stories, writing scripts, and ensuring that the content aligns with the broadcast's tone and timing. Anchor Producers also coordinate with reporters, editors, and technical staff to deliver a seamless and engaging news program. Their role is crucial in maintaining the quality and accuracy of news presentations.

How does an anchor producer typically collaborate with on-air talent and newsroom teams during live broadcasts?

Anchor Producers play a crucial role in coordinating with both on-air anchors and the wider newsroom team to ensure a smooth broadcast. They are responsible for briefing anchors on key stories, updating scripts in real time, and relaying breaking news or last-minute changes via in-ear communication. Frequent collaboration with directors, writers, and technical staff is essential to manage timing, graphics, and transitions. Strong communication and adaptability are vital, as producers often need to respond quickly to evolving news situations while keeping the anchor well-informed and composed on air.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as an anchor producer?

To thrive as an Anchor Producer, you need strong editorial judgment, news writing expertise, and a background in journalism or communications. Experience with newsroom software, rundown management systems, and editing tools like ENPS, iNews, or Avid is typically required. Exceptional organizational skills, clear communication, and the ability to work calmly under deadline pressure are vital soft skills for this role. These abilities ensure accurate, timely, and compelling newscasts that keep audiences informed and engaged.

What We Need:

We're seeking an experienced Traffic and Weather Reporter to cover overnight shifts as a Produce and on air Anchor.

What You'll Do:

  • Gather regional traffic information and enter details into internal computer and web systems

  • Read traffic reports, commercials, and public service messages to listeners

  • Identify, research, and create copy regarding traffic to feature during on-air shift; finalizes content using digital audio editing software

  • Manage information; keeping all facts straight, making sure details are accurate and current, and tracking any changes

  • Maintain crucial deadlines in order to provide traffic updates in a timely fashion

  • May prepare written content, visual images, audio material and video footage for websites, blogs, or other social-media platforms

What You'll Need:

  • Knowledge of local coverage area geography and roadways, mass transit and traffic patterns

  • Experience with Microsoft Office, including MS Word, Excel, PowerPoint, and SharePoint

  • Pleasant, charismatic and well-controlled voice; excellent pronunciation

  • Experience working in a fast-paced, deadline-oriented, "newsroom-like" collaborative environment

  • Ability to plan and organize, set priorities and multi-task in a fast-paced environment

  • Must be willing to work split shifts; 4 hours in AM Drive, 4 hours in PM Drive

  • Must be willing to work weekends

  • Previous on-air broadcast experience

  • College degree is preferred but not required
